jquery-license:jQuery Foundation许可证验证

时间:2024-05-25 01:09:50
【文件属性】:

文件名称:jquery-license:jQuery Foundation许可证验证

文件大小:23KB

文件格式:ZIP

更新时间:2024-05-25 01:09:50

JavaScript

jQuery Foundation许可证验证 此模块审核jQuery Foundation存储库,以确保所有提交都可以通过或CAA获得适当的许可。 它既可以作为对存储库给定分支的全面审核来运行,也可以验证拉取请求中的所有提交。 后者可以通过网络挂钩自动完成。 要手动检查PR,请使用githubToken (下一部分)设置config.json ,然后运行audir-pr脚本(请参见下面的PR Auditing)。 设定档 审核脚本需要一些配置。 在此模块的根目录中使用以下属性创建一个config.json : owner (默认: "jquery" ):要审核的GitHub用户/组织。 当将jquery-license作为Webhook服务器运行时,可以将此属性指定为字符串数组而不是单个字符串,以针对多个所有者/组织检查拉取请求。 repoDir (默认: "repos" ):将存储


【文件预览】:
jquery-license-main
----.jshintrc(226B)
----.gitignore(45B)
----.jscsrc(73B)
----package.json(1KB)
----bin()
--------audit-branch.js(1KB)
--------audit-pr.js(764B)
--------server.js(4KB)
----exceptions()
--------jquery-ui.js(1KB)
--------jquery.js(139B)
----index.js(438B)
----LICENSE.txt(2KB)
----README.md(5KB)
----lib()
--------signatures.js(3KB)
--------pr.js(6KB)
--------exceptions.js(231B)
--------repo()
--------comment.hbs(686B)
--------config.js(665B)
--------validate.js(766B)
--------repo.js(829B)
----test()
--------signatures.js(2KB)
--------signatures-caa.json(514B)
--------signatures-cla.json(3KB)
--------repo.js(12KB)
--------server.js(2KB)

网友评论